“make them use it” is not a valid EMR adoption strategy



"Of course we are all aware that a traditional EMR rollout is a huge financial commitment (thus raising the financial risk considerably, in addition to the operational risk of upending the healthcare organisation for a minimum of two years while the project is implemented). In many cases, those risks are well flagged and whilst typically underestimated, they have at least been given strong consideration. However the biggest risk to such a project is usually one that doesn’t receive much attention – user adoption"

BreastScreen Victoria

BreastScreen Victoria

BreastScreen Victoria in Australia aims to reduce the impact of a breast cancer diagnosis ensuring you have the best health outcome through early detection accross the state of Victoria. They assist women to make informed decisions about their approach to the early detection of breast cancer and target our breast mammography services to Victorian women aged 50–74.

The outstanding success of the Vitro pilot has informed the decision to expand the paperless system to the rest of BreastScreen Victoria. Over the coming months, further development is planned in preparation for a state-wide expansion.  “Our clinicians found the software easy to use, and our team found that the time taken to issue written results reduced from 12 days to one or two. The new digital whiteboard has improved patient flow, providing for a better experience for both patients and staff.” Dr Helen Frazer, Clinical Director at St Vincent’s BreastScreen

Health Band-Aid

Health Band-Aid

A national electronic record has been so slow in coming, the private service providers are stepping up with their own systems, writes Tim Binsted.

Calvary, a Catholic non-profit operator of 15 public and private hospitals, 15 retirement and aged-care facilities and 22 community care centres, has been rolling out its Vitro digital records and patient chart system following a successful trial last year at its 60-bed Bethlehem hospital in Melbourne. Belinda Mcrae, the nurse unit manager on the St Teresa's ward at Bethlehem, says "We were the pilot of MedChart, the online medication chart It has made a huge difference for being able to read medication orders and keeping track of doses. The reduction in incidence of missed medication is amazing," she says. "From a workflow point of view, being able to access the same record at the same time [as other staff] is huge... I don't think we could go back." It only takes about 10 minutes to teach new staff to use the system, and Mcrae says the Vitro record, which can digitally replicate the look and feel of paper, makes it easier to track shifts and pick up issues, such as missed or overdue medications.

Operation Smile, going paperless using Vitro

Operation Smile, going paperless using Vitro

Vitro Software together with Microsoft are official technology partners to Operation Smile, Inc.. Vitro Software donated its software Vitro®, an Electronic Medical Record (EMR) solution to Operation Smile, allowing them to collect patient data electronically during their 180+ global missions and reducing their reliance on paper.Operation Smile is an international medical charity that has provided hundreds of thousands of free surgeries for children and young adults in developing countries who are born with cleft lip, cleft palate or other facial deformities. It is one of the oldest and largest volunteer-based organizations dedicated to improving the health and lives of children worldwide through access to surgical care.
